RV-SUV Petrol Cars

RV-SUV Petrol 4WD (4x4) vehicles have become increasingly popular in New Zealand, blending the versatility of recreational vehicles with the robust performance of sport utility vehicles. These cars are well-suited to the diverse and often challenging driving conditions across the country, from urban environments to rugged rural landscapes.

One of the main advantages of petrol-powered RV-SUVs with 4WD is their strong and responsive engine performance. Petrol engines typically provide smooth acceleration and higher revving capabilities compared to diesel counterparts, which can be beneficial for quick overtaking on winding Kiwi roads. The 4WD system enhances traction by delivering power to all four wheels, crucial for navigating wet, gravelly, or uneven terrain often encountered on New Zealand’s backcountry tracks and mountainous regions.

The ability to switch between two-wheel drive and four-wheel drive modes optimizes fuel efficiency during everyday city driving while ensuring maximum grip when required. This adaptability makes these vehicles excellent for a variety of uses—from family outings around town to adventurous trips into areas like the West Coast or Central Otago, where off-road capability is important.

RV-SUVs tend to offer spacious interiors and practical storage options that accommodate outdoor gear such as camping equipment, fishing rods, or mountain bikes—perfect for active lifestyles common in New Zealand. Additionally, modern models come equipped with advanced safety features including hill descent control, electronic stability programs, and multiple airbags that enhance driver confidence on steep inclines or slippery surfaces frequently experienced throughout the country.

For New Zealand drivers seeking a balance between everyday usability and adventure readiness, petrol-fueled RV-SUV 4WD vehicles deliver a dependable solution with dynamic handling characteristics tailored to local roads and terrain challenges. Their combination of comfort, power, and off-road prowess supports both urban commuting needs and exploring New Zealand’s spectacular outdoors.
